mikroC provides a library for handling Manchester coded signals. Manchester
code is a code in which data and clock signals are combined to form a single self-
synchronizing data stream; each encoded bit contains a transition at the midpoint
of a bit period, the direction of transition determines whether the bit is a 0 or a 1;
second half is the true bit value and the first half is the complement of the true bit
value (as shown in the figure below).

Notes: Manchester receive routines are blocking calls (

Man_Receive_Config

,

Man_Receive_Init

,

Man_Receive

). This means that PIC will wait until the

task is performed (e.g. byte is received, synchronization achieved, etc). Routines
for receiving are limited to a baud rate scope from 340 ~ 560 bps.
